What does Sage Group do?

The Sage Group PLC is a publicly traded company based in the United Kingdom and is a global leader in business software solutions. The company was founded in 1981 by David Goldman with the aim of helping small and medium-sized businesses manage their finances more efficiently. Since then, the Sage Group PLC has steadily grown and has become a prominent provider of software solutions for entrepreneurs and self-employed individuals. Business Model The business model of the Sage Group PLC is designed to help small and medium-sized businesses make their finances and operational processes more efficient and productive. The core business is divided into different divisions to provide customers with tailored solutions: 1. Financials: This is a comprehensive financial software that helps businesses optimize their financial accounting, invoicing, payment processing, and payroll. 2. Enterprise Management: This division offers a software solution for businesses that need to manage their operations in real-time. It includes features such as inventory management, sales management, and production optimization. 3. People & Payroll: This is an HR management solution for businesses of all sizes. The software includes features such as personnel administration, performance management, employee development, and payroll processing. 4. Payments & Banking: This division offers companies a range of payment and financing solutions, including online payments, direct debits, and card payments. Products The Sage Group PLC offers a wide range of products to ensure that there is a suitable solution for every business. As one of the world's leading providers of business software, the company offers a variety of applications that can be tailored to the specific needs of businesses of all sizes. Some of Sage's key products include: 1. Sage 50cloud: This accounting software is designed for small businesses and offers features such as invoicing, inventory management, and online payments. It also allows collaboration with accountants and bookkeepers. 2. Sage Business Cloud Accounting: This cloud-based accounting software is suitable for small businesses and freelancers and provides a simple yet powerful solution for managing finances and invoices. 3. Sage Intacct: This product is designed for larger companies or organizations and offers comprehensive financial services tailored to the customer's individual requirements. 4. Sage HR: This HR management software provides a powerful solution for managing personnel matters, including hiring, training, and performance management. Decoding Sage Group's Return on Equity (ROE)

Sage Group's Return on Equity (ROE) is a fundamental metric evaluating the company's profitability relative to its equity. Calculated by dividing net income by shareholder's equity, ROE illustrates how effectively the company is generating profits from shareholders’ investments. A higher ROE represents enhanced efficiency and profitability.

Year-to-Year Comparison

Analyzing Sage Group's ROE on a yearly basis aids in tracking its profitability trends and financial performance. An increasing ROE suggests enhanced profitability and value generation for shareholders, whereas a declining ROE may indicate issues in profit generation or equity management.

Impact on Investments

Sage Group's ROE is instrumental for investors assessing the company's profitability, efficiency, and investment attractiveness. A robust ROE indicates the firm’s adeptness at converting equity investments into profits, thereby enhancing its appeal to potential and current investors.

Interpreting ROE Fluctuations

Changes in Sage Group’s ROE can emanate from variations in net income, equity capital, or both. These fluctuations are scrutinized to evaluate management’s effectiveness, financial strategies, and the inherent risks and opportunities, aiding investors in making informed decisions.

Stock savings plans offer an attractive way for investors to build wealth over the long term. One of the main advantages is the so-called cost-average effect: by regularly investing a fixed amount in stocks or stock funds, you automatically buy more shares when prices are low, and fewer when they are high. This can lead to a more favorable average price per share over time. In addition, stock savings plans allow small investors access to expensive stocks, as they can participate with small amounts. Regular investment also promotes a disciplined investment strategy and helps to avoid emotional decisions, such as impulsive buying or selling. Furthermore, investors benefit from the potential appreciation of the stocks as well as from dividend distributions, which can be reinvested, enhancing the compounding effect and thus the growth of the invested capital.
